Detailed Description
Dive into the extended narrative that explains the scientific background, objectives, and procedures in greater depth.
This study consists of one screening visit, 5 study intervention visits, and a 1-week follow-up visit. After obtaining informed consent, study staff will assess for changes in medical history an pelvic pain treatments since the end of participation in Part 1 (IRB 2019-362). Urine will be collected for urinalysis and a urine pregnancy test will be collected for women of childbearing potential. If urinalysis and pregnancy test are negative, subjects will complete questionnaires, vitals, and a baseline EEG will be conducted.
At the 5 interventional visits, transcranial direct stimulation (tDCS) with guided imagery will be delivered. A EEG will be completed after the 1st and 5th treatment visits. At each visit questionnaires will be administered and urine pregnancy test, if the woman is of childbearing potential. At the 1-week follow- up visit, an EEG will be performed, questionnaires administered.

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Active tDCS with guided imagery
Subjects will receive 2 miliamps of electrical stimulation to the brain (transcranial direct stimulation-tDCS) for 20 minutes concurrently while listening to a guided imagery CD specifically designed for women with chronic pelvic pain.
Active tDCS with guided imagery
The subject will be positioned in the sitting/reclining position in a quiet room with lights dimmed. The tDCS device and audio headphones will be placed on the subject's head. The tDCS device to be used is the Soterix Medical 1X1 device using 2.0 mA of current. The electrodes that will be used will be standard sponge electrodes. The subject will listen to a scripted guided imagery CD specifically developed for women with chronic pelvic pain through the audio headphones. The guided imagery plus active tDCS arm will have 20 minutes of stimulation with 25 minutes of guided imagery.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Female
* Age 18 to 64 years
* Women must either be unable to become pregnant (are surgically sterile or postmenopausal) or must use an approved method of birth control throughout the study period.
* Self-reported CPP defined as pelvic pain that is non-cyclical and of at least 6 months duration and refractory to other treatments
* Subject agrees to not start any new treatment (medication or otherwise) throughout the treatment and follow up periods.
* Subject agrees to maintain stable doses of all current medications throughout the treatment and follow-up period.
Exclusion Criteria
* Pacemaker
* Currently using tobacco
* Use of carbamazepine, oxcarbazepine, phenytoin, pramipexole or cabergoline within the past 6 months as self-reported
* Parkinson's Disease
* Any condition, including neurological or psychiatric illness, which per investigators' judgement may increase subject risk
* History of Hunner's lesions
* Lactation, pregnancy, or refusal to use medically approved/reliable birth control in women of child-bearing potential
* Sacral or pudendal Interstim® or spinal cord stimulator that is "on"
* Contraindications to tDCS stimulation (e.g. metal in the head, implanted brain medical devices, scalp wounds or infections, etc)
* History of head injury resulting in more than a momentary loss of consciousness during the last 2 years
Deferral Criteria
1. If a subject has a confirmed UTI per investigator's clinical judgment, she will be deferred until treatment is completed and symptoms resolve
2. Participating in another intervention study, or received an investigational drug or device within 4 weeks prior to screening
3. Subject received bladder hydrodistention within the past 12 weeks
4. Within the past four weeks, initiation of any new medications or any intravesical treatment for treatment of IC/BPS.
5. Within the past 24 weeks received any surgery or procedure which may impact the pelvic floor
* Note: For the sake of preserving scientific integrity, one of more of the eligibility criteria have been left off this list posting while the trial is ongoing. A full list of eligibility criteria will be posted upon completion of the trial.
